Uttar Pradesh polls: Shivpal Yadav changes 17 names, Akhilesh ‘not aware’

Murder accused Amanmani, scam accused Mukesh Srivastava in revised list.

SAMAJWADI PARTY’S Uttar Pradesh unit president Shivpal Yadav on Monday announced nine new candidates, including murder accused Amanmani Tripathi who is facing a CBI probe, and replaced 17 names announced earlier for next year’s Assembly elections.

Among those who have been replaced is an SP youth leader considered close to Chief Minister Akhilesh Yadav. Asked about the new list, Akhilesh said he was “not aware” of it.

The party also announced the candidature of Mukesh Srivastava, a Congress MLA who joined the SP last month, from Payagpur seat in Bahraich. Srivastava is accused in one of the cases related to the multi-crore NRHM scam.

Avoiding a direct reply on the decision to replace Atul Pradhan, the former president of SP students’ wing Samajwadi Chhatra Sabha, Akhilesh said the polls are still far away and candidates may get changed in the interim. “No one knows what happens in politics,” he said on the sidelines of a function here. To another question, Akhilesh, who was fighting a turf war with uncle Shivpal until recently, said, “I can be either truthful or political. I cannot change some of my habits.”

About the candidature of Amanmani, son of Amarmani Tripathi (convicted of murdering poet Madhumita Shukla) and himself charged with murdering his wife, Akhilesh, indicating that all is not well in the SP despite a public rapprochement between him and Shivpal, said, “It is an internal party matter. But everyone is aware of my opinion on such matters.”

Reminded of his earlier statement that he would have a say in selection of candidates, the Chief Minister responded: “Maine sab adhikar tyag diye hain. Yeh janata ko tay karna hai” (I have abdicated all rights. Now the public has to be take decisions).”

Atul Pradhan was replaced by Mainpal Singh from Sardhana constituency in Meerut. Pradhan had lost from Sardhana in
2012.

Shivpal also replaced 16 other names from the list of 142 candidates announced in March, when Akhilesh was party’s state unit president.

Ramgopal Yadav later met Mulayam and said it is the right of the party’s state president to announce candidates. He said there is no rift in the party over distribution of tickets.
